    A1—0 to 8 centimeters (0.0 to 3.1 inches); brown (10YR 4/3), light yellowish brown (10YR 6/4), dry; fine sandy loam; weak fine subangular blocky structure; very friable;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.7,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059201
    A2—8 to 25 centimeters (3.1 to 9.8 inches); brown (10YR 4/3) fine sandy loam; weak fine subangular blocky structure; very friable; fragments; slightly acid, pH 6.1,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059202
    Bw1—25 to 51 centimeters (9.8 to 20.1 inches); 60 percent brown (10YR 4/3) and 40 percent dark grayish brown (10YR 4/2) silt loam; weak fine subangular blocky structure; very friable; moderate permeability;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.8,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059203
    2Bw2—51 to 61 centimeters (20.1 to 24.0 inches); dark yellowish brown (10YR 4/4) loam; weak fine subangular blocky structure; very friable;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.9,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059204
    3C1—61 to 140 centimeters (24.0 to 55.1 inches); yellowish brown (10YR 5/6) and light yellowish brown (10YR 6/4) coarse sand; single grain; loose; fragments; moderately acid, pH 6.0,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059205
    3C2—140 to 157 centimeters (55.1 to 61.8 inches); yellowish brown (10YR 5/6) and light yellowish brown (10YR 6/4) sand; single grain; loose; rapid permeability; fragments; moderately acid, pH 6.0,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059206
    3C3—157 to 173 centimeters (61.8 to 68.1 inches); very pale brown (10YR 7/4) and yellowish brown (10YR 5/6) coarse sand; single grain; loose; 10 percent by volume nonflat rounded indurated 2-40-75 millimeter chert fragments; slightly acid, pH 6.1, hellige-truog. Lab sample # MU059207
